Abstract

A key positioning structure is used for positioning a key to a shell of an electronic device. The key comprises a press portion and a suspension arm extending from one end of the press portion, the suspension arm comprises a first positioning hole and a positioning column arranged at the tail end of the suspension arm, and the positioning column comprises a retaining portion which is protrudingly arranged on the surface of the positioning column. The shell is provided with a through hole and comprises a positioning block and a positioning pin extending from the inner surface of the shell, the positioning block is provided with a second positioning hole, and the positioning column is inserted into the second positioning hole to enable the retaining portion to penetrate through the second positioning hole. The key is rotated to enable the positioning pin to be contained in the first positioning hole of the suspension arm, one side of the press portion is contained in the through hole of the shell, and the retaining portion of the positioning column is retained at the bottom of the second positioning hole, so that the key is positioned on the shell. Using the key positioning structure can guarantee the key against damage and reduce key assembly cost.

Background technology
Usually, the button of electronic installation comprises press section and the cantilever that end extends to form from one of said press section.The housing of said electronic installation comprises reference column, and said cantilever comprises location hole.In the prior art, the reference column of housing passes the location hole of cantilever and adopts hot melting way that reference column and cantilever are combined so that button is positioned housing.This kind fixed form, owing to need to adopt fuse machine that button is located, button is scalded easily in reflow process, and fuse machine costs an arm and a leg, and causes cost waste.
